Welcome to the homepage of "The Contributions of Businesspersons to Economics," a one-day conference organized by Rob Van Horn (University of Rhode Island) and Eddie Nik-Khah (Roanoke College). The conference will be held in room 113 Social Science at Duke University on Friday, November 13, 2015, and is being funded by the Department of Economics at Duke University.

The conference will begin on that Friday morning at 9:00 and end with dinner that evening.
